Packers Week 5 Injury Report: Jaire Alexander is out for the second straight game

Despite returning to practice at the end of the week, Green Bay Packers cornerback Jaire Alexander will not play in Sunday afternoon’s game against the Los Angeles Rams.

Alexander was one of the Packers listed as inactive for the game before kickoff, meaning he will miss a second straight game. He missed last week’s game against the Minnesota Vikings after suffering a groin injury in practice before that game. Joining Alexander on the inactive list are wide receiver Christian Watson, who injured his ankle in last Sunday’s game and didn’t practice at all during the week, and rookie offensive lineman Jordan Morgan, who was hoping to return after a few weeks away.

However, the Packers have several other members of the team listed as questionable on Friday’s injury report, available Sunday. This group includes players like tight end Luke Musgrave, linebacker Edgerrin Cooper and cornerback Carrington Valentine. Valentin’s return is particularly important as Alexander is out this week. If Valentine plays, he will likely start at boundary corner opposite Eric Stokes, which should allow Keisean Nixon to return to his usual role in the slot.

Here is the complete list of the Packers’ inactive players this week:

  • CB Jaire Alexander
  • EN Brenton Cox, Jr.
  • OT Travis Glover
  • OL Jordan Morgan
  • WR Christian Watson
  • DT Devonte Wyatt

Meanwhile, the Rams are still without wide receiver Cooper Kupp, while fellow top receiver Puka Nacua remains on injured reserve. That should make the task at least a little less challenging for Valentine and Co. in the Packers’ secondary. The Rams’ inactives are as follows:

  • QB Stetson Bennett
  • OL Geron Christian
  • LB Brennan Jackson
  • DE Desjuan Johnson
  • WR Cooper Kupp
  • RB Cody Schrader
  • CB Tre’Davious White
